Eagle Rare 10 & 12 Year Old Bundle 750mL brings together two distinguished Kentucky straight bourbon whiskeys from Buffalo Trace Distillery, offering bourbon enthusiasts the opportunity to experience Eagle Rare at two different stages of maturation. This bundle includes Eagle Rare 10 Year Old Bourbon and Eagle Rare 12 Year Old Bourbon, creating an exceptional side-by-side tasting experience that highlights the influence of additional aging. The 10 Year is bottled at 90 proof, while the 12 Year steps up to 95 proof, adding greater maturity and intensity to the Eagle Rare profile.
The Eagle Rare 10 Year delivers classic notes of toffee, orange peel, honey, oak, candied almond, and rich cocoa, finishing dry and lingering. The Eagle Rare 12 Year builds upon that foundation with sweet oak and almond aromas followed by vanilla, toasted oak, and a rich toffee finish. Together, these two expressions provide a compelling comparison of age, proof, and flavor within one of Buffalo Trace’s most celebrated bourbon families.

FAQS
• What comes in the Eagle Rare 10 & 12 Year Old Bundle?
This bundle includes one 750mL bottle of Eagle Rare 10 Year Old Kentucky Straight Bourbon Whiskey and one 750mL bottle of Eagle Rare 12 Year Old Kentucky Straight Bourbon Whiskey.
• What is the difference between Eagle Rare 10 and 12 Year?
Eagle Rare 10 is aged for 10 years and bottled at 90 proof, while Eagle Rare 12 is aged for at least 12 years and bottled at 95 proof, delivering additional maturity and a more oak-forward profile.
• Who produces Eagle Rare Bourbon?
Both expressions are produced by Buffalo Trace Distillery in Frankfort, Kentucky.
• Is Eagle Rare 12 Year different from Eagle Rare 17 Year?
Yes. Eagle Rare 12 Year is its own expression and should not be confused with Eagle Rare 17 Year, which is released annually as part of the Buffalo Trace Antique Collection.
• How should these bourbons be enjoyed?
Both are excellent served neat or over a large ice cube. This bundle is particularly well suited for a side-by-side tasting to compare how the additional two years of maturation influence the whiskey.
• What are the ABV and proof?
Eagle Rare 10 Year is 45% ABV (90 proof), while Eagle Rare 12 Year is 47.5% ABV (95 proof).
